Transaction 3696cfd48255a788ce2816282f39097a70dba2c6676967ffc2f32a46e2299d54
1 Input
2 Outputs
- 3696cfd48255a788ce2816282f39097a70dba2c6676967ffc2f32a46e2299d54:0
- 3696cfd48255a788ce2816282f39097a70dba2c6676967ffc2f32a46e2299d54:1
value 24889894
address 37qcC9jWgTXYEtrm8PVJCwx8birxYzbBuX
value 682992
address 1KJRzY6sGgGFsTKWyvCLTymVSqd7VppDnC